So we'd like to > confirm whether you want to remain as a Project Management Committees > (PMC) member of Apache ServiceComb project? > > I just quote some roles description of PMC from How it works of Apache[2]. > If you just heard about PMC, please spend some time to read about the > role of PMC and understand the responsibilities, and let me know if > you have any question about it. > > " The role of the PMC from a Foundation perspective is oversight. The > main role of the PMC is not code and not coding - but to ensure that > all legal issues are addressed, that procedure is followed, and that > each and every release is the product of the community as a whole. > That is key to our litigation protection mechanisms. > > Secondly the role of the PMC is to further the long term development > and health of the community as a whole, and to ensure that balanced > and wide scale peer review and collaboration does happen. Within the > ASF we worry about any community which centers around a few > individuals who are working virtually uncontested.
